Furness Railway / Port of Barrow printed volume "Ramsden Dock - Report of Tides, Weather, Gates &c." containing details of tide heights, wind direction and force, weather conditions, number of vessels in and out, time of opening of gates etc. at Ramsden Dock, Barrow-in-Furness. Entries run from 6 December 1881 to 21 November 1885.

Furness Railway / Port of Barrow volume "Ramsden Dock Entrance Tide Guage" recording times and levels of high water, wind, weather conditions, whether the gates opened, and vessels in and out, for Ramsden Dock, Barrow-in-Furness. Entries run from 3 November to 31 December 1876 and from 1 June 1879 to 22 October 1881. Detailed entries begin on 1 July 1879.
